Handover note — for whoever's on dispatch tonight

Hi, quick brain-dump before I head off. The spare parts for the Corvel Ridge pump station finally cleared the warehouse — two crates, gaskets and the replacement impeller. The site's been running on the backup since Tuesday, so Renata up there is understandably twitchy. Truck is booked for the 05:30 slot; make sure the crates go on first so they come off first at the depot transfer. The confidential hand-over instruction for the courier is right below this note.

dispatch memo: the lamwyn fenwyn courier leaves the wenir ledger at gate 7175 under passcode 822969

Meeting notes (excerpt) — Quaverly relocation sync, Tuesday

Quick recap for the team at the new Ashfell Park site: vans from Tollgate Movers start arriving Friday around nine, furniture first, IT crates after lunch. Dena asked that someone prop the side doors and keep the freight lift free all morning. Labels are colour-coded — blue for third floor, green for second. One sealed crate travels separately by courier, and the confidential hand-over instruction for it appears directly below.

dispatch memo: the eliok quenok courier leaves the sorael aldath belion tammir casix gileth queniel jorath ledger at gate 9299 under passcode 897989

## Changelog — Font vendoring defaults changed

As of this release, the Bracken UI build no longer fetches third-party fonts at build time. All typefaces used by the Lanternwell suite are now vendored into the repo under a dedicated assets directory, and the fetch step is skipped by default. If you're onboarding, nothing to install — the fonts travel with the checkout. The build flags controlling this behavior are listed below.

settings of hadup-yafog:
LAMAEL_PIN=3761
LAMAEL_TENANT=istmir
LAMAEL_METRICS_HOST=metrics.lamael.plorvasys.test
LAMAEL_SEAL=seal_8ea68500
LAMAEL_STANDBY_TEAM=fraok

Ticket: BKY-341 — Misconfigured staging env for order-cutoff rule

Hi, and welcome to the Crumbletop team. Staging is currently accepting orders past the 2 p.m. cutoff because ORDER_CUTOFF_HOUR was never set, so the scheduler fell back to midnight. Please set ORDER_CUTOFF_HOUR=14 and confirm the timezone variable matches the Harborview bakery's local time. The cutoff service also needs its signing credential, which belongs on the next line.

sealed setting: VAULT_KEY20=c8ea1e419912889df6b4